Seite 1 von 1

Admin soll User "offline" anlegen können

Verfasst: 22.03.2006 22:27
von Benjamin_DO
Hallo,
suche einen MOD der es mir erlaubt einen neuen User anzulegen ohne dass er sich selber registrieren muss.

Ich hoffe es weiß jemand was ich meine :)

Der User soll dann per eMail von mir den Benutzernaman und dass Passwort mitgeteilt bekommen können.

Besten Dank
Benjamin

Verfasst: 22.03.2006 22:49
von buegelfalte
Warum registrierst du ihn dann nicht einfach online ?
Damit die Mail an den User verschickt werden kann, muß ja schließlich irgendwer online sein - geht m.E. am einfachsten und ist in einer Minute erledigt ...

Verfasst: 22.03.2006 22:49
von ATARI

Verfasst: 22.03.2006 22:51
von buegelfalte
oder so :)
aber "offline" ist das ja trotzdem nicht ...

Verfasst: 22.03.2006 22:55
von Benjamin_DO
ATARI hat geschrieben:e voila http://www.phpbbhacks.com/download/2901
thx

finde ich dafür auch irgendwo eine deutsche sprachdatei?
habe einen admin der kein wort englisch spricht :)

Verfasst: 22.03.2006 22:57
von buegelfalte
die brauchst du nicht - der holt sich alle Sprachvariablen aus der "normalen" Sprachdatei, da die Texte alle schon im Registrierungsformular vorkommen

Verfasst: 22.03.2006 23:20
von Benjamin_DO
thx

Verfasst: 23.03.2006 15:12
von buegelfalte
Hab das Ding gerade mal getestet ... was mir dabei wirklich noch fehlt: es wird an den neu registrierten User keine Mail mit den Zugangsdaten verschickt ... halte ich eigentlich für essentiell das Feature ... da muß ich wohl mal lecker beikommen ...

Verfasst: 23.03.2006 15:44
von buegelfalte
So, jetzt wird auch die Standard-Welcome-Mail mit den Zugangsdaten an den neu registrierten User verschickt - es wird keinen Unterschied gemacht, ob Coppa aktiviert ist oder nicht (wie bei der "richtigen" Registrierung), aber das sollte ja eh hinfällig sein, wenn der Admin den User selbst registriert.

here u go:

Code: Alles auswählen

#
#-----[ OPEN ]------------------------------------------
#
admin/admin_user_register.php

#
#-----[ FIND ]------------------------------------------
#
		$message = $lang['Account_added'];

#
#-----[ BEFORE, ADD ]------------------------------------------
#
		include($phpbb_root_path . 'includes/emailer.'.$phpEx);
		$emailer = new emailer($board_config['smtp_delivery']);

		$emailer->from($board_config['board_email']);
		$emailer->replyto($board_config['board_email']);

		$emailer->use_template('user_welcome', stripslashes($user_lang));
		$emailer->email_address($email);
		$emailer->set_subject(sprintf($lang['Welcome_subject'], $board_config['sitename']));

		$emailer->assign_vars(array(
			'SITENAME' => $board_config['sitename'],
			'WELCOME_MSG' => sprintf($lang['Welcome_subject'], $board_config['sitename']),
			'USERNAME' => preg_replace($unhtml_specialchars_match, $unhtml_specialchars_replace, substr(str_replace("\'", "'", $username), 0, 25)),
			'PASSWORD' => $password_confirm,
			'EMAIL_SIG' => str_replace('<br />', "\n", "-- \n" . $board_config['board_email_sig']))
		);

		$emailer->send();
		$emailer->reset();

Verfasst: 23.03.2006 18:33
von John Doe
Gibt es gut gelöst hier,
ist ein mod aus dem Modding Wettbewerb bei phpbb.com

Deutsches Sprachaddon ist auf Seite 2

http://www.phpbb.com/phpBB/viewtopic.php?t=364461


MOD Name: ACP User Registration
Author: Fountain of Apples
MOD Description: Allows quick registration of new users to the board from within the ACP.

Features:

* Simple Mode for quick registration of a user with just username/e-mail/password
* Advanced Mode allowing control of all details (minus avatar) during registration
* User is immediately activated regardless of activation settings
* Ability to choose to send an e-mail notification to the new user when registered
* Ability to automatically add the user as a member to specified usergroups